Hyderabad cybercrime police register complaints and a case involving Meta’s India head and operators of multiple Facebook and Instagram accounts over alleged objectionable and morphed content targeting Prime Minister Narendra Modi. The reports say the complaints are linked to posts that circulate manipulated videos and images, which BJP supporters allege were shared during the time of CJP protests. Police are tracing the individuals behind the social media accounts that reportedly posted or circulated the material. In addition, notices are reportedly issued to Meta regarding the objectionable links referenced in the complaints. The cases are based on allegations that the content includes objectionable material and edits of images or videos aimed at the prime minister. Police statements in the coverage indicate the investigation focuses on identifying account operators and gathering evidence tied to the reported posts. The reports also note that police action follows complaints filed by supporters who allege that the content was manipulated and disseminated online.
